High Barnet Summer Festival 2011
Plans are underway. masterminded by the Barnet Residents Association, for a 10-day festival this summer to showcase local talent and places of entertainment.
It will run from 17th – 26th June.
This is a new venture and, if successful, could become an annual event.
The Barnet Society is organising a Concert of music at St John the Baptist Church on Wednesday 22 June.
